CC -!- FUNCTION: Poorly processive, error-prone DNA polymerase involved in
CC untargeted mutagenesis. Copies undamaged DNA at stalled replication
CC forks, which arise in vivo from mismatched or misaligned primer ends.
CC These misaligned primers can be extended by PolIV. Exhibits no 3'-5'
CC exonuclease (proofreading) activity. May be involved in translesional
CC synthesis, in conjunction with the beta clamp from PolIII.
